A Phase 1 Study of PRT12396 in Participants With Select Myeloproliferative Neoplasms

Summary
This is a first-in-human, open-label, multi-center Phase 1 study designed to evaluate the safety, tolerability, pharmacokinetics, and preliminary efficacy of PRT12396 in participants with high-risk polycythemia vera (PV) and myelofibrosis (MF), and to determine the maximum tolerated dose (MTD) and recommended dose(s) for expansion (RDE\[s\]). The study consists of a dose-escalation phase followed by a dose-expansion phase to further evaluate selected dose level(s).

Trial Details
NCT Number NCT07469891
Lead Sponsor Prelude Therapeutics
Conditions Polycythemia Vera (PV), Myelofibrosis (MF), Myeloproliferative Neoplasms (MPNs), Post-Polycythemia Vera Myelofibrosis, Post-Essential Thrombocythemia Myelofibrosis, Primary Myelofibrosis (PMF)
Enrollment 100 participants
Start Date 2026-04-29
Primary Completion 2028-04 (estimated)
Study Completion 2028-04 (estimated)
